I recently purchased an entire coin collection from a friend, left to him by his Grandfather. He had some ASE's 1986 thru 2001, in a display type case/box, with a glass cover. All of them have a blue tint toning on the Reverse, some have toning on the Obverse. I was wanting opinions on would this type toning be considered natural and does it add any value to ASE's.
